  • Patent number: 6491094
    Abstract: A control system for a heating, ventilating, and air conditioning unit having a heating stage, a cooling stage, and an economizer is provided. The system includes a memory configured to store a first predetermined temperature range and a second predetermined temperature range. The system also includes a control having an input device configured to receive an indoor air temperature representative of the air in one or more zones and a supply air temperature representative of the air entering the one or more zones. The control selectively activates at least one of the heating stage, the cooling stage, and the economizer when the indoor air temperature is outside of the first predetermined temperature range. The control also selectively activates at least one of the heating stage, the cooling stage, and the economizer when the indoor air temperature is within the first predetermined temperature range and the sensed temperature of the supply air is outside of the second predetermined temperature range.

  • Patent number: 6318966
    Abstract: A system and method for controlling the stage of a compressor motor and/or fan motor of a heating, ventilation, and air-conditioning system. Preferably, said system and method are used with a reversible, two stage compressor motor. The method includes, for example, switching at least one contactor connected to a source of line power to remove the source of line power to a set of relays and to a compressor motor containing a run winding, a start winding, and a common lead; waiting a predetermined period of time; and controlling the set of relays by switching the set of relays to provide the source of line power to permit switching the source of line power to either the run winding or the start winding, wherein prior to the step of controlling, the at least one contactor removes the source of line power from the set of relays.

  • Patent number: 6250382
    Abstract: A method and system for controlling a heating, ventilating, and air conditioning unit is provided. The system includes a conditioning unit having a heating stage, a cooling stage, and a fan. The conditioning unit operates in an active mode where one of the heating stage and the cooling stage is activated to condition air in an enclosure. The conditioning unit also operates in a ventilation mode to provide supply air to the enclosure. A supply temperature sensor is provided to sense the temperature of the supply air. A central control operates to activate one of the heating stage and the cooling stage when the conditioning unit is operating in the ventilation mode and the temperature of the supply air is outside of a predetermined range.

  • Patent number: 5971067
    Abstract: The present invention is a system for controlling the quality of air in a building. The system includes a sensor disposed for sensing the air quality in a building. Upon a sensing of an air quality problem, the system issues a command to draw in additional outside air into the building to alleviate the problem. The issuing of such command can be made conditional on a measurement of outside air temperature. The flow of additional outside air may be limited or avoided altogether where drawing in additional outside air would adversely affect the inside air temperature. Additional air can be drawn into a building, for example, by opening an economizer, activating a fan system, or by increasing a pressure setpoint in a supply air duct.

  • Patent number: 5305953
    Abstract: Method and apparatus are disclosed for responding to an unpermissible rise in the supply air temperature in any zone of a variable air volume system. A warning is generated to a controller in each zone which adjusts the air flow to the zone within predetermined limits. Different adjustment occur depending on whether the temperature of the space being heated is below the zone setpoint or above the zone setpoint.
